以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  如何用一个文本框加载字符型或数值型数据?  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=43903)

--  作者:hzcaqjf
--  发布时间:2013/12/18 15:36:00
--  如何用一个文本框加载字符型或数值型数据?
想在窗口"textbox1"中无论输入字符型或数值型数据,都能从外部表(access数据库)"表A"加载数据:
Dim txt As String = e.Form.controls("TextBox1").Text
If txt = "" Then
    DataTables("表A").LoadFilter = "[_Identify] Is Null"
Else
    DataTables("表A").LoadFilter = "[收款单位] Like \'%" & txt & "%\' Or [付款单位] Like \'%" & txt & "%\' Or [摘要] Like \'%" & txt & "%\' Or convert([金额],\'system.string\') = " & txt & ""
    DataTables("表A").Load
End If
提示convert函数无效.应该怎样写代码?

--  作者:Bin
--  发布时间:2013/12/18 15:41:00
--  
ACCESS用 CStr

CStr(金额)

--  作者:hzcaqjf
--  发布时间:2013/12/18 16:05:00
--  
问题已解决,多谢Bin老师!